WebAnticoagulants are a group of medications that decrease your blood’s ability to clot. They do that by letting your body break down existing clots or by preventing new clots from forming. Anticoagulants come in many different forms, including injections, intravenous (IV) drugs, and medications you take by mouth. WebNov 12, 2002 · Tips on Self-Injection of Low Molecular Weight Heparin Select a site where you can “pinch an inch” of fat, usually the abdomen, thigh, or hip. Stay at least 3 fingerbreadths away from the belly button. Cleanse the injection site gently with an alcohol swab prior to injection, but do not rub or swab the site after injection.
